rsync – Linux服务器同步到Amazon S3存储桶

我正在寻找一个稳定的解决方案,使用rsync将经典服务器备份替换为另一台服务器.
我必须将整个文件系统(超过1Tb)同步到Amazon S3.

我在哪里?

解决方案1:
我使用s3fs将S3存储桶映射到系统中的安装点.
系统变得不稳定,流量非常慢.这绝不是一个解决方案.

解决方案2:
使用s3cmd sync命令.一切顺利,速度很快(至少低于2Gb的文件夹).
当我尝试同步服务器上的所有文件系统时(包含一些排除项),问题就来了.这个过程刚刚挂起.

任何提示

解决方法

这是一种不好的备份方式.您应该将操作系统配置与有价值的数据分开.您的所有权限都不会被转移,如果您计划恢复备份,那么在 Linux世界中这些权限是必需的(您应该这样做 – 没有经过验证的修复的备份是没有意义的).

首先,您可以使用s3cmd同步将有价值的实例数据(例如/ var / www)同步到S3,如您所述.

其次,使用配置管理实用程序(如Puppet或Chef),您可以轻松地启动操作系统的新实例,从而确保一组新的可靠配置.

您的问题中没有基础架构的详细信息(EC2?VMware?KVM?Xen?物理硬件?)因此我不推荐任何特定工具(即特定于架构的快照).如果您在虚拟平台(例如EC2,VMware,KVM)上运行,那么您应该使用该平台的快照架构.

相关文章

1、安装Apache。 1)执行如下命令,安装Apache服务及其扩展包...
一、先说一下用ansible批量采集机器信息的实现办法: 1、先把...
安装配置 1. 安装vsftpd 检查是否安装了vsftpd # rpm -qa | ...
如何抑制stable_secret读取关键的“net.ipv6.conf.all.stabl...
1 删除0字节文件 find -type f -size 0 -exec rm -rf {} ...
## 步骤 1:安装必要的软件包 首先,需要确保系统已安装 `dh...